VHT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

773 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Health Care ETF (VHT)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$4.84B — up 10% from $4.39B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 73 funds opened new VHT posit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 47 holders — while 278 added to existing stakes and 181 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Beacon Capital Management Inc (Ohio), adding an estimated $198M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$42M.
